Q: Is 27,840,305 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 27,840,305 is a composite number.

Why is 27,840,305 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 27,840,305 can be evenly divided by 1 5 17 85 127 635 2,159 2,579 10,795 12,895 43,843 219,215 327,533 1,637,665 5,568,061 and 27,840,305, with no remainder.

Since 27,840,305 cannot be divided by just 1 and 27,840,305, it is a composite number.
